How can I become a different type of developer?


Hi all.

I feel typecast. For my entire career I've been in C++ roles. In the course of this I have dabbled with other languages/technologies but not enough.

I see jobs with "must have x years experience with Java/C#" and I really think I could do it, but will I get screened out at CV time?

I'm learning C# in my spare time but how do I move from being typecast? Thanks


  👤 magicbuzz Accepted Answer ✓
I was a full time Python dev but the complexity of the work required wasn’t interesting enough for me. I wanted to move into web dev. So in 2014 I sat down and wrote an FTP/SFTP client in 100% Javascript (a plug-in for an editor). It impressed enough people that I eventually moved into a web dev role. If you write something that seems involved/complex enough, people will credit you as being capable in that language.
